Two-dimensional usually referred to fictional two-dimensional worlds or characters and elements in anime, manga, games, and other media. This term originated from Japan and was widely used in Japanese anime, manga, and game culture. In the 2D world, people could experience a wonderful world that was different from the real world. The characters and elements had unique personalities and styles, and they were often expressed in exaggerated ways. As a unique form of entertainment and social activities, the 2D culture was deeply loved by some young people. Historical fiction means creating stories that are set in a historical era but have elements of imagination and fictional elements added. It allows authors to explore what might have happened during that time or tell tales of characters who could have existed. A good example is 'Gone with the Wind', which is set during the American Civil War but has fictional characters and events.
